Understanding Parkinson's Disease
Parkinson's disease is a neurodegenerative disorder that primarily affects the motor system. It occurs when nerve cells in the brain that produce dopamine, a vital neurotransmitter, begin to die. This deficiency leads to difficulties in coordinating movement.
Some key points about Parkinson's disease include:
- It is a progressive condition, meaning symptoms worsen over time.
- It affects individuals differently, with symptoms varying in severity and manifestation.
- While the exact cause is unknown, genetics and environmental factors may play a role.
Common Symptoms of Parkinson's Disease
The symptoms of Parkinson's disease can be broadly categorized into motor and non-motor symptoms.
Motor Symptoms
- Tremors: Involuntary shaking, often starting in the hands.
- Bradykinesia: Slowness of movement, making everyday tasks more challenging.
- Rigidity: Muscle stiffness that can limit range of motion.
- Postural Instability: Difficulty maintaining balance, increasing the risk of falls.
Non-Motor Symptoms
- Depression and anxiety: Common emotional challenges faced by individuals.
- Cognitive impairment: Difficulties with memory and thought processes.
- Sleep disturbances: Issues with falling asleep or staying asleep.
Treatment Options for Parkinson's Disease
While there is currently no cure for Parkinson's disease, various treatment options aim to manage symptoms and improve quality of life.
Common treatment strategies include:
- Medications: Such as levodopa, which helps replenish dopamine levels.
- Physical therapy: To improve mobility and strength.
- Occupational therapy: To assist with daily activities and adapt to challenges.
- Surgery: In some cases, deep brain stimulation may be considered.
